Colorectal - Adjuvant Rectal
Intergroup Randomized Phase III Study of Postoperative Oxaliplatin, 5-Fluorouracil and Leucovorin vs Oxaliplatin, 5-Fluorouracil, Leucovorin and Bevacizumab for Patients with Stage II or III Rectal Cancer Receiving Pre-operative Chemoradiation

 

This research study is for patients that have received chemotherapy and radiation therapy prior to their surgery for Stage II or III rectal cancer.  The purpose of the study is to compare the effects of adding an investigational drug (Avastin/bevacizumab) to other chemotherapy agents (5-FU, Oxaliplatin, Leucovorin) after patients with advanced rectal cancer have had pre-operative chemoradiation.
